ฉันใช้ Ubuntu 20.04 และไม่สามารถเปิดเทอร์มินัล การตั้งค่า ตัวอัปเดตซอฟต์แวร์ และ ...
ฉันต้องใช้เทอร์มินัล vscode แทน
ก่อนติดตั้ง Django และ python3.9 ฉันไม่มีปัญหานี้
ฉันคิดว่ามีบางอย่างผิดปกติกับ python ในคอมพิวเตอร์ของฉัน
นี่คือข้อผิดพลาดที่ฉันได้รับ:
ข้อผิดพลาด 1: เมื่อฉันเรียกใช้ sudo apt do-release-upgrade
ในเทอร์มินัล vscode ของฉัน:
Traceback (การโทรครั้งล่าสุดล่าสุด):
ไฟล์ "/usr/bin/do-release-upgrade" บรรทัดที่ 11 ใน <โมดูล>
จาก UpdateManager.Core.MetaRelease นำเข้า MetaReleaseCore
ไฟล์ "/usr/lib/python3/dist-packages/UpdateManager/Core/MetaRelease.py" บรรทัดที่ 25 ใน <โมดูล>
นำเข้าฉลาด
ไฟล์ "/usr/lib/python3/dist-packages/apt/__init__.py", บรรทัดที่ 23 ใน <โมดูล>
นำเข้า apt_pkg
ModuleNotFoundError: ไม่มีโมดูลชื่อ 'apt_pkg'
error2: และเมื่อฉันเรียกใช้ คำพังเพย-terminal
ในเทอร์มินัล vscode ของฉัน:
Traceback (การโทรครั้งล่าสุดล่าสุด):
ไฟล์ "/usr/bin/gnome-terminal" บรรทัดที่ 9 ใน <โมดูล>
จาก gi.repository นำเข้า GLib, Gio
ไฟล์ "/usr/lib/python3/dist-packages/gi/__init__.py", บรรทัด 42 ใน <โมดูล>
จาก . นำเข้า _gi
ImportError: ไม่สามารถนำเข้าชื่อ '_gi' จากโมดูลเริ่มต้นบางส่วน 'gi' (น่าจะเกิดจากการนำเข้าแบบวงกลม) (/usr/lib/python3/dist-packages/gi/__init__.py)
เมื่อฉันต้องการเรียกใช้แอปพลิเคชันจาก GUI ไม่แสดงข้อผิดพลาด และไม่สามารถเปิดแอปพลิเคชันได้
ฉันต้องการอัปเกรดเป็น Ubuntu 21.04 และบันทึกโครงการ Python/Django ของฉัน
อัปเดต
เมื่อฉันเปลี่ยนเวอร์ชัน Python เป็น 3.8 และไม่สามารถรันโปรเจ็กต์ Python และ Django ได้